Gower Commons

description Gower Commons Overview

The Gower Commons encompass a network of lowland heath, grassland, and marshes located on the Gower Peninsula in Swansea, Wales. This landscape is situated within the Gower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ty, which was designated in 1956 as the first AONB in the United Kingdom. The area is managed to preserve its traditional common land practices, diverse wildlife habitats, and archaeological heritage.

help Gower Commons FAQ

Where are the Gower Commons located in the UK?

The Gower Commons encompass a vast network of lowland heath and marshes located in Swansea, Wales. They are uniquely situated right on the coast, sitting entirely within the boundaries of the Gower Peninsula.

What historic designation does the area surrounding the Gower Commons hold?

The commons are located directly within the first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ty (AONB) designated in the United Kingdom. The Gower Peninsula received this prestigious status in 1956, recognizing its incredible coastal landscapes.

What kind of agriculture takes place on the Gower Commons?

For centuries, the land has been used as common land for grazing ponies, sheep, and cattle. The local farmers' rights to graze their livestock on the heath are strictly regulated by the Gower Commoners Association to ensure the landscape does not become overgrown.

What kind of wildlife thrives on the Gower Commons?

The network of lowland heaths and marshes supports rare wildlife, including the iconic Welsh mountain pony. The wet, acidic conditions are also highly attractive to carnivorous plants and provide a hunting ground for rare birds of prey like the hobby.
